<h1>Duty free import regime for EPZ units enables export production with Customs coordination and specific procurement exemptions.</h1> EPZs operate as duty free enclaves offering infrastructure and fiscal incentives to promote exports; Customs and Central Excise notifications permit duty free import and local procurement of capital goods, raw materials and consumables under specified conditions. Development Commissioners coordinate with Customs to provide bond facilities and ensure inputs are used for export production. EPZ units follow the same import, DTA sale and procedural rules as EOUs, are not required to obtain the customs licence referenced in the manual and are exempt from cost recovery charges for Customs staff in the Zone.
